Client Details

PageGroup are delighted to support a well-established manufacturing organisation based in Redditch with the appointment of a HR Transformation Partner to join for circa 12 months (possible scope for extension/permanent)

This role can offer hybrid working (Business needs dependent)

Description

The role of HR Transformation Partner will work alongside a HR Director and SLT, this will include but not limited to:

  • Contribute to the design and implementation of the People Strategy within the business.
  • Facilitate organisational change and promote a positive working environment.
  • Work closely with senior leaders to ensure HR initiatives align with business goals.
  • Contribute to the improvement and development of HR systems, policies and procedures.
  • Support with restructures and change management projects
  • Manage HR projects and initiatives aligned with the business strategy.
  • Support with cultural transformation and contribute to a positive and successful environment

Profile

Ideal candidates for this role will have a proven background within similar roles.

Ideally (but not essentially) you will have experience within large/corporate organisations within the manufacturing sector.

Job Offer

  • A competitive salary range around circa £60,000- £70,000 DOE
  • Hybrid working available
  • 12 months interim with possible scope for extension/permanent
